Overview

For decades, non-profit organizations such as the American Heart Association and the National Kidney Foundation have engaged in mutually beneficial partnerships or cause alliances with drug firms. 

In general, these pairings have been viewed favorably because they have educated the public and improved medical care. 

Today however, the landscape is changing. The public deeply mistrusts the pharmaceutical industry.  Also, critics have accused non-profits of working with drug firms to "disease monger."  According to the journal PLoS Medicine, this refers to the "selling of sickness that widens the boundaries of illness and grows the markets for those who sell or deliver treatments."  These trends threaten to diminish the credibility and effectiveness of pharma-non-profit cause alliances. 

This report is designed to help executives from pharmaceutical companies and non-profits (especially patient groups and medical societies):

  • Understand the evolution of the disease mongering debate in the media and why it is important
  • Recognize how disease mongering-related media coverage has influenced reporting about cause alliances
  • Dive into the latest public opinion data on pharmaceutical industry support of non-profits
  • Learn why preserving the power of cause alliances will require proactive communication and increased transparency
